Calories in andean pisca
A typical serving of andean pisca provides about 228 calories. Here are the full macros and nutrition facts.
Per serving · 1 bowl (350 g)
Calories
228kcal
Protein
10.8g
Carbs
26.3g
Fat
9.8g
Per 100 g
| Calories | 65 kcal |
| Protein | 3.1 g |
| Carbs | 7.5 g |
| Fat | 2.8 g |
| Saturated fat | 1.2 g |
| Fiber | 0.8 g |
| Sugars | 1.5 g |
| Sodium | 280 mg |

Comforting soup from the Venezuelan Andes made with chicken broth, milk, potatoes, cheese, and cilantro.
Nutritional benefits
- Hydrating and comforting
- Provides calcium from milk and cheese
- Low in calories if cheese is controlled
How to prepare it
- 1.Cook potatoes in broth until almost tender before adding milk
- 2.Do not let the soup boil vigorously after adding milk
- 3.Add cheese and cilantro just before serving to preserve textures

Frequently asked questions
Is it eaten for breakfast?
Yes, it is the traditional breakfast in Andean states to combat the morning cold.
Does it have eggs?
Some versions include a poached egg inside the hot soup.
Cilantro substitute?
Cilantro is essential for the flavor profile of Pisca; it is hard to substitute.
